Table 1.
Location and MNI coordinates were given for the clusters with significant correlation between fractional anisotropy and WISC-RC math scores.
| Statistical values | MNI coordinates anatomical location | ||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Cluster size | t-value | x | y | z | Region |
| 2808 | 4.13 | −27 | −66 | 44 | L inferior longitudinal fasciculus |
| 2071 | 4.6 | −11 | −77 | 32 | L inferior longitudinal fasciculus |
| 749 | 2.98 | −33 | −83 | 24 | L inferior fronto-occipital fasciculus |
| 673 | 4.03 | −29 | −7 | −8 | L inferior fronto-occipital fasciculus |
| 578 | 3.88 | 27 | −39 | 17 | R inferior fronto-occipital fasciculus |
| 482 | 4.68 | −33 | −47 | 47 | L superior longitudinal fasciculus |
| 476 | 3.75 | −44 | −62 | 35 | L superior longitudinal fasciculus |
The MNI coordinates and t-values for the local maxima of the centers of the clusters; R, right hemisphere; L, left hemisphere. The statistical threshold of all reported clusters were set at p < 0.05 using AlphaSim correction (with combination of threshold of p < 0.01 and a minimum cluster size of 473 voxels). The correlation analyses were adjusted for full-scale IQ, age and gender.
